Hurricanes Travel to Gainesville for Florida Relays
CORAL GABLES, Fla. – The University of Miami track and field team hits the road for the first time in the outdoor season as the Hurricanes travel to Gainesville for the Pepsi Florida Relay on Friday and Saturday at the Percy Beard Track.
Action gets underway at 11 a.m. with the women’s hammer throw with action on the track beginning at 2:30 p.m. with the women’s 4×100 relay.
Saturday’s competition starts at 11 a.m. with the men’s discus. Running events are slated to begin at noon with the women’s 100m hurdles.
The Hurricanes registered five events win at the highly-competitive Hurricane Collegiate Invitational as the women’s team entered the national rankings at No. 21.
Adriana Kruzmane extended her nation-leading mark in the triple jump to 13.48m, over a foot longer that next-highest mark. Freshman Dominique Johnson holds the nation’s fourth-longest distance in the triple jump at 13.00m.
On the men’s side, Tyson Schiele earned ACC Freshman of the Week honors after setting the school’s second-longest throw in the javelin at 73.29m. The throw ranks eighth nationally and is first among all freshmen.
